The ingredients needed to make Roasted garlic, potato & arugula pizza:
  1. Prepare 1 unbaked pizza crust
  2. Take 2 tsp olive oil
  3. Make ready 5 cloves roasted garlic, peeled
  4. Get 2 small thin-skinned potatoes
  5. Take 1-2 tsp dried thyme, or 1 tbsp fresh
  6. Make ready 1 pinch salt
  7. Get 4-5 small sun-dried tomaties in oil chopped
  8. Take 8-10 Kalamata olives, pitted and chopped
  9. Take 1 handful arugula
  10. Get 1 tbsp roasted pine nuts

Steps to make Roasted garlic, potato & arugula pizza:
  1. For the roasted garlic: Pre-heat oven to 200°C. Cut the top off a bulb of garlic, drizzle on the olive oil over top, and roast in the oven for 15-20 minutes, or until they are golden and bubbly. Remove from the oven and let cool. The garlic can be squeezed from the peel once cooled.
  2. Place the pizza dough on a flat sheet and drizzle with the olive oil. Place the roasted garlic onto the crust and mash it using the back of a fork, distributing it evenly over the crust.
  3. Wash and cut the potato into thin rounds, and layer over the garlicky crust. You want to slice the potatoes as thinly as possible so they cook in the same amount of time it takes to cook the crust. Sprinkle with the thyme and a dash of salt. Bake for 10-15 minutes, or until the crust is golden.
  4. Remove from oven and top with sun-dried tomatoes, olives, roasted pine nuts and arugula. Slice and enjoy!
